For economic-policy reasons, usually to encourage (or in some
cases, discourage) investments, tax laws specify which
depreciation methods and which depreciable lives are
permitted. Suppose the government permitted accelerated
depreciation to be used, allowing for higher depreciation
deductions in earlier years. Should Vector then use accelerated
depreciation? Yes, because there is a general rule in tax
planning for profitable companies such as Vector: When there
is a legal choice, take the depreciation (or any other deduction)
sooner rather than later. Doing so causes the (cash) income tax
savings to occur earlier, which increases a project’s NPV.
3. Terminal Disposal of Investment. The disposal of an investment
generally increases as inflow of a project at its termination. An
error in forecasting the disposal value is seldom critical for a
long-duration project because the present value of the
amounts to be received in the distant future is usually small. For
Vector, the two components of the terminal disposal value of
an investment are (a) the after-tax cash flow from the terminal
disposal of buses and (b) the after-tax cash flow from recovery
of working capital.
3a. After-tax cash flow from terminal disposal of buses. At the
end of the useful life of the project, the bus’s terminal
disposal value is usually considerably less than the net
initial investment (and sometimes zero). The relevant cash
inflow is the difference in the expected after-tax cash
inflow from terminal disposal at the end of 5 years under
the two alternatives. Disposing of both the existing and
the new bus will result in a zero after-tax cash inflow in
year 5. Hence, there is no difference in the disposal-related
after-tax cash inflows of the two alternatives.
Because both the existing and new bus have disposal
values that equal their book values at the time of their
disposal (in each case, this value is $0), there are no tax
effects for either alternative. What if either the existing or
the new bus had a terminal value that differed from its
book value at the time of disposal? In that case, the
approach for computing the terminal inflow is identical to
that for calculating the aftertax cash flow from current
disposal illustrated earlier in item 1c.
3b. After-tax cash flow from terminal recovery of working
capital investment. The initial
investment in working capital is usually fully recouped
when the project is terminated. At that time, inventories
and accounts receivable necessary to support the project
are no longer needed. Vector receives cash equal to the
book value of its working capital. Thus, there is no gain or
loss on working capital and, hence, no tax consequences.
The relevant cash inflow is the difference in the expected
working capital recovered under the two alternatives. At
the end of year 5, Vector recovers $36,000 cash from
working capital if it invests in the new hybrid bus versus
$6,000 if it continues to use the old bus. The relevant cash
inflow at the end of year 5 if Vector invests in the new bus
is thus $30,000 ($36,000 – $6,000).
Some capital investment projects reduce working
capital. Assume that a computer-integrated manufacturing
(CIM) project with a 7-year life will reduce inventories and,
hence, working capital by $20 million from, say, $50
million to $30 million. This reduction will be represented as
a $20 million cash inflow for the project in year 0. At the
end of 7 years, the recovery of working capital will show a
relevant incremental cash outflow of $20 million. That’s
because, at the end of year 7, the company recovers only
$30 million of working capital under CIM, rather than the
$50 million of working capital it would have recovered had
it not implemented CIM.

Project Management and Performance Evaluation
We have so far looked at ways to identify relevant cash flows and
techniques for analyzing them. The final stage (Stage 5) of capital
budgeting begins with implementing the decision and managing the
project. This includes management control of the investment activity
itself, as well as the project as a whole.
Capital budgeting projects, such as purchasing a hybrid bus or
videoconferencing equipment, are easier to implement than projects
involving building shopping malls or manufacturing plants. The
building projects are more complex, so monitoring and controlling
the investment schedules and budgets are critical to successfully
